Beautiful medium sized grassed campsites in a small bay nestled right above the water. There’s actually 3 different areas you can camp, two of them overlook the ocean and beach and a 3rd sits further back. One area offers private restrooms for R370 per site, the other which we chose is R290 with very clean shared restrooms. We stayed in site 40A and highly recommend it! No access to any vehicle over 4m high. Restuarant right below campsites. Shopping Mall 10mins drive away.

Report Check-InWe stayed two days at this campsite and enjoyed the view over the ocean and down to the beach. The village has only 13 houses at the waterfront, a restaurant and a surfshop.
Report Check-InGreat campsites with beautiful view of surfers paradise Vic Bay.
Option of private ablutions or shared. We opted for private as we went during high season and the camp was quite busy. The ablutions were well maintained and we had nice hot showers. Washing up facilities are shared with the site next door.
Should you wish to surf, there are board/wettie hire places around.
